Kennedy Space Center Director Bill Parsons this morning asked for the Brevard County Commission’s support lobbying for increased NASA funding.

Parsons said another tight budget next year could lengthen the transition from the space shuttle to its successor, Orion, potentially costing Brevard space-related jobs.  Read more
